**Alert: TurnstileCounterStalled**

This fires when the Gatewick turnstile counter at Harrow Field Stadium reports no increments for ten minutes during a scheduled event. It usually indicates a stuck sensor feed rather than an actual crowd stoppage, but treat every occurrence seriously until confirmed. Begin by checking the gate controller heartbeat, then follow the triage steps documented here.

runbook for badug-kadup: https://confluence.zemvarlabs.internal/projects/browse/display/projects/bd1b

## Replica Lag Alarm — Security Review Notes

The Tarnwell lag alarm polls each read replica every 15s and pages when lag exceeds 90s. Polling runs from the ops subnet only; no customer data leaves the cluster. Thresholds live in config, not code. Alarm acknowledgements are audit-logged to Ledgerpine. To query the alarm's internal API during review, authenticate with the key below.

service key, fawip-bajef: kto11_Qt5wZK9vdNC

Welcome to the Fanline team at Quellworks. Our notification fan-out service pushes alerts to millions of subscribers, and backpressure is the main thing that keeps it from falling over. When the downstream queue depth crosses the threshold in FANLINE_QUEUE_LIMIT, producers are throttled automatically. You don't need to tune this on day one, but you do need local credentials to run the throttle simulator. Copy env.sample to .env, then add the broker signing secret on the next line of your .env file.

sealed setting: ARCHIVE_KEY3=8d0